Learn what "why don't you tell me" means, when people say it, and how to use it naturally in English.

This means the speaker wants the other person to explain something directly.
From I Think My Wife Wants To Kill Me S2, Episode 51
The speaker pushes the other person to answer instead of staying silent.
Use it when you want an answer and feel the other person is withholding information. It can sound annoyed or confrontational depending on tone.
